Integrar com aplicativo de terceiros ou usar plug-in nativo do WordPress?

Minha pergunta para você é como você vê o futuro (ou mesmo o presente) da integração de software com o WordPress e quando você deve fazer a distinção entre a integração e a abordagem nativa.

Em outras palavras, com o vasto ecossistema de plug-ins do WordPress lá fora, como um proprietário de site pode discernir com quais responsabilidades o WordPress o software deve lidar e se essa funcionalidade é realmente melhor para conectar outro software ou serviço?

Alex

Houve um tempo em que eu diria construir todas as coisas no WordPress. Eu era mais jovem, um pouco mais ingênuo. Eu estava otimista sobre o uso do WordPress como uma estrutura para construir qualquer coisa. Há uma parte de mim que ainda se inclina nessa direção. Principalmente porque eu quero ver o que os desenvolvedores do ecossistema WordPress podem alcançar. Eu aplaudo qualquer um que empurra a plataforma além de seus limites atuais.

Poucas pessoas teriam imaginado que o WordPress se tornaria uma potência do comércio eletrônico. No entanto, WooCommerce provou que isso pode ser feito. Ainda me lembro quando quase todos os autores de temas e plugins do WordPress estavam vendendo seus produtos comerciais via E-junkie. Agora, Easy Digital Downloads é a solução ideal, e AffiliateWP cuida do lado afiliado das coisas.

Alguns dos melhores produtos do mercado de plug-ins para WordPress surgiram de problemas com integração de aplicativos de terceiros. Seus criadores resistiram ao sistema e trouxeram ferramentas úteis diretamente para o WordPress. Muitos deles são agora produtos e empresas multimilionários que empregam dezenas, centenas ou mesmo milhares de pessoas. Eles têm seus próprios ecossistemas que permitem que ainda mais desenvolvedores terceirizados ganhem a vida. E tudo isso é feito em cima do WordPress.

Sempre vou torcer para o time da casa, para os desenvolvedores em nossa comunidade, para construir soluções nativas.

No entanto, a realidade é que o WordPress não é a melhor solução para tudo. Dependendo do aplicativo, a equipe de desenvolvimento provavelmente dedicou anos de trabalho, criando um sistema especializado que atende aos usuários desse aplicativo. A experiência muitas vezes pode ser muito melhor do que algo disponível para WordPress.

Não consigo imaginar usar o WordPress como a espinha dorsal de um site de vídeo social como o YouTube, mesmo que fosse um site pequeno. Os custos de hospedagem seriam astronômicos. É muito mais fácil e barato confiar na integração com o YouTube em vez de tentar reconstruí-lo.

Na correspondência original de Alex, ele também mencionou um caso específico sobre a integração com um fórum de terceiros. Este é um dilema muito mais realista do que um usuário médio tentando construir o próximo YouTube. Também é uma pergunta que não tem uma resposta única.

Para usuários que estão criando fóruns em seus sites pela primeira vez, meu conselho é que optem pelo bbPress. É um plugin que traz fóruns nativos para o WordPress. Embora não seja tão poderoso quanto alguns aplicativos de fórum de terceiros, seu melhor recurso é que ele funciona diretamente com os sistemas integrados de usuário, função e capacidade do WordPress. Essas são algumas das APIs mais complexas do WordPress, e tentar sincronizar contas de usuário entre aplicativos pode muitas vezes ser uma dor de cabeça. É também um tópico técnico complexo que vai além do escopo deste post. Se começar do zero, eu recomendaria o bbPress ou outro plugin de fórum do WordPress.

Por outro lado, se um usuário já tiver um fórum existente com uma grande quantidade de conteúdo, eu tenderia a integrá-lo ao WordPress, especialmente se o proprietário do site planeja manter os registros de usuários estritamente no software do fórum. Muito disso se resumirá àquilo com que o usuário final se sentirá confortável. Se eles têm um forte histórico com o aplicativo existente, fazer uma alteração pode simplesmente não ser o melhor caminho. Há outros itens a serem considerados, como se é necessário compartilhar um único tema em ambas as plataformas. O bbPress também pode importar conteúdo de muitos aplicativos de fórum existentes.

A resposta à pergunta é que depende. Cada caso de uso é diferente.

Um vendedor popular no Etsy deve transferir tudo para o WooCommerce? Provavelmente não. Esse usuário pode querer instalar o plugin de integração Etsy Shop. Eventualmente, eles podem expandir sua marca o suficiente para não depender mais da plataforma Etsy. Nesse ponto, WooCommerce poderia ser a resposta.

Tudo se resume a tempo, custo, pesquisa e teste. Mesmo quando um plugin traz uma solução nativa para WordPress que é ideal para a maioria das pessoas, pode não ser a melhor resposta para um indivíduo. Os detalhes são importantes e sempre fico feliz em conversar sobre eles.

Esta é a segunda postagem da série Ask the Bartender. Tem uma pergunta própria? Atire.



Source

Deixe uma resposta

%d blogueiros gostam disto: